Lemak = Cream, in culinary terms, it refers to coconut milk or a dish that has been cooked with coconut milk. Instructions to make Nasi Lemak (coconut milk rice, chicken gravy and fried chicken):
  1. Add coconut milk,sliced ginger,pandan leaf and salt to rice. Mix well. Let it cook in electric cooker
  2. Mix cooked rice slowly
  3. Blend garlic,ginger and dried chili into smooth paste
  4. Mix turmeric and salt with chicken pieces. Deep Fry
  5. Keep aside fried chicken pieces
  6. Stir fry onion and tomato, add blended chili paste
  7. Let the gravy cook until oil breaks. Add fried chicken pieces. Stir and mix. Let it cook until gravy thickens
  8. For fried chicken mix all ingredients and deep fry
  9. Boil eggs
  10. Slice cucumber into thin slices
  11. Fry anchovies
  12. Serve all cooked dishes in one plate as a set of meal
